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/csharp/276.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
C# Winform类到主程序_C#_Winforms_Class - Fatal编程技术网

C# Winform类到主程序

C# Winform类到主程序,c#,winforms,class,C#,Winforms,Class,我如何让主程序认识到我有一个需要参考的课外课程 我创建了一个类“Hello” 我需要引用这个类的一个实例 private Hello hello1=new Hello() 但是,当我写出这段代码时,它不识别“Hello”作为开头。如果Hello类不在同一个项目中,则必须添加对“Hello类”项目的引用 但首先,只需检查它们是否在同一名称空间中。如果没有,请添加 使用代码 或者将Hello类的名称空间更改为与Winform的名称空间相同 (名称空间的名称正好出现在“using”声明之后:名称空间{

我如何让主程序认识到我有一个需要参考的课外课程

我创建了一个类“Hello” 我需要引用这个类的一个实例

private Hello hello1=new Hello()


但是,当我写出这段代码时,它不识别“Hello”作为开头。

如果Hello类不在同一个项目中,则必须添加对“Hello类”项目的引用

但首先,只需检查它们是否在同一名称空间中。如果没有,请添加

使用代码

或者将Hello类的名称空间更改为与Winform的名称空间相同


(名称空间的名称正好出现在“using”声明之后:
名称空间{

如果Hello类不在与您表单相同的项目中,您必须添加对“Hello类”项目的引用

但首先,只需检查它们是否在同一名称空间中

在WinForm类中使用;

或者将Hello类的名称空间更改为与Winform的名称空间相同


(名称空间的名称正好出现在“using”声明之后:
名称空间{

如果您的hello类与主程序在同一个项目中,您可以通过添加raphael提到的using语句来完成。如果它们不在同一个项目中,您应该首先添加包含hello类的项目的引用。假设您有2个项目。1个主程序(包括主程序)第二个是hello项目(包括hello类)。在visual studio extend主项目中,右键单击引用并选择“添加引用”,然后选择hello项目


希望足够清楚。

如果您的hello类与主程序在同一个项目中,您只需添加raphael提到的using语句即可。如果它们不在同一个项目中,您应该首先添加包含hello类的项目的引用。假设您有2个项目。1个主程序(包括主程序)第二个是hello项目(包括您的hello类)。在visual studio extend main项目中,右键单击引用并选择“添加引用”,然后选择hello项目


希望它足够清楚。

你应该给我们一个更好的线索来说明什么是错的。你的代码是在同一个项目中还是在不同的项目中?你的
Hello
类的访问修饰符是什么?你应该给我们一个更好的线索来说明什么是错的。你的代码是在同一个项目中还是在不同的项目中?你的类的访问修饰符是什么ode>你好
课堂?